Find the distance d. (2,4) and (7,2)

Respuesta :

MrGumby
MrGumby MrGumby
  • 29-03-2019

Answer:

The answer is d = [tex]\sqrt{29}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the distance, use the distance formula.

d = [tex]\sqrt{(x1 - x1)^{2} + (y1 - y2)^{2}  }[/tex]

d = [tex]\sqrt{(7 - 2)^{2} + (2 - 4)^{2}  }[/tex]

d = [tex]\sqrt{(5)^{2} + (-2)^{2}  }[/tex]

d = [tex]\sqrt{25 + 4 }[/tex]

d = [tex]\sqrt{29}[/tex]
